Posted

You need to make sure your folders are set up right

 

Go into forge/mcp/src/minecraft

 

Create a folder called "assets" if there isn't one already

 

then create a folder inside assets called "komag"

 

then create a folder inside komag called "textures"

 

then create your "items" "blocks" "entities" ect folders

 

put your texture inside the relevant folder

 

that's the setup I use and all my textures work fine

I got it working!  With a little foolery with Eclipse, and it turned out I needed /mcp/src/komag/assets/komag/textures.  Bit redundant, but it works!  Something with taking the "komag.assets.komag.textures" entries, turning them into source folders, then removing them from the build path kicked Eclipse and Minecraft in the rear and she's working like a charm, thankee!

 

For those looking here for a solution to this problem, the aforementioned folders are in the /mcp/src folder, ie the Minecraft project, and NOT your mod project folders.
